The Rise of AI-Powered App Development
Artificial intelligence (AI) is no longer a futuristic concept; it’s a present-day reality profoundly impacting app development. AI-powered tools are streamlining processes, enhancing user experiences, and unlocking new possibilities for innovation.
One significant trend is the use of AI in code generation. Tools like OpenAI‘s Codex are capable of automatically generating code snippets based on natural language prompts. This can significantly reduce development time and lower the barrier to entry for aspiring app creators.
AI is also playing a crucial role in app testing. Traditional manual testing is time-consuming and prone to human error. AI-powered testing platforms can automate the process, identifying bugs and performance issues with greater speed and accuracy. This leads to more stable and reliable apps, improving user satisfaction.
Furthermore, AI is revolutionizing app personalization. By analyzing user data, AI algorithms can tailor app content, features, and recommendations to individual preferences. This creates a more engaging and relevant user experience, boosting retention and conversions.

Enhanced User Experience with Intelligent Interfaces
The user experience (UX) is paramount to the success of any app. Intelligent interfaces, powered by AI, are taking UX to the next level. These interfaces are designed to be more intuitive, responsive, and personalized.
Natural Language Processing (NLP) is a key component of intelligent interfaces. NLP enables apps to understand and respond to user input in natural language, making interactions more conversational and human-like. Chatbots, powered by NLP, are becoming increasingly common in customer support and engagement.
Computer vision is another area where AI is enhancing UX. Apps can now use computer vision to recognize objects, faces, and scenes, enabling new and innovative features. For example, apps can use computer vision to identify products in a photo and provide relevant information or shopping recommendations.
Predictive analytics is also playing a crucial role in creating intelligent interfaces. By analyzing user behavior, apps can anticipate user needs and proactively offer relevant information or suggestions. This creates a more seamless and personalized user experience.
The Impact of 5G and Edge Computing on App Performance
The rollout of 5G networks and the rise of edge computing are having a profound impact on app performance. These technologies are enabling faster data transfer speeds, lower latency, and greater processing power, leading to more responsive and feature-rich apps.
5G’s increased bandwidth allows for the delivery of high-quality video and audio content, making it ideal for streaming apps, gaming apps, and augmented reality (AR) applications. The lower latency of 5G also enables real-time interactions, which is crucial for applications like online gaming and remote control systems.
Edge computing brings processing power closer to the user, reducing latency even further. This is particularly important for applications that require real-time data processing, such as autonomous vehicles and industrial automation systems.
The combination of 5G and edge computing is also enabling the development of new and innovative apps that were previously impossible. For example, AR applications can now use edge computing to process complex data locally, reducing the need to send data to the cloud and improving performance.
Blockchain Integration for Enhanced Security and Transparency
Blockchain technology is increasingly being integrated into apps to enhance security and transparency. Blockchain’s decentralized and immutable nature makes it ideal for applications that require trust and accountability.
One common use case is in identity management. Blockchain-based identity systems can provide users with greater control over their personal data, reducing the risk of identity theft and fraud.
Blockchain is also being used to create secure and transparent supply chains. Apps can use blockchain to track the movement of goods from origin to consumer, ensuring authenticity and preventing counterfeiting.
Furthermore, blockchain is enabling new business models in the app ecosystem. For example, decentralized apps (dApps) can use blockchain to create peer-to-peer marketplaces and reward users for their contributions.

Low-Code/No-Code Platforms Empowering Citizen Developers
Low-code/no-code platforms are democratizing app development, enabling individuals with little or no coding experience to create their own apps. These platforms provide a visual interface and pre-built components that simplify the development process.
Low-code/no-code platforms are empowering citizen developers to create apps for a wide range of purposes, from automating business processes to building mobile games. This is expanding the app ecosystem and fostering innovation.
These platforms also offer several benefits for professional developers. They can use low-code/no-code platforms to quickly prototype new ideas, build proof-of-concepts, and automate repetitive tasks.
However, it’s important to note that low-code/no-code platforms are not a replacement for traditional development. Complex and mission-critical apps may still require custom coding.
